Great camera, lousy software, no mount for iMac G4. 
2006-11-04
I purchased two iSights so that I can videoconference with my mom and sister. The cameras work fine (but do get very hot if you keep them on for a long time). The only problem I still have is with the software (iChat). It works videoconferencing with my mom, but does not work videoconferencing with my sister. All of us use Macs. I have researched extensively in the apple support site, without success... changed firewall settings, router settings... none worked. The only way for me to videoconference with my sister is via Skype, which has poorer image quality.
The camera also lacks a mount for the iMac G4, so it has to sit beside the computer screen (not on top of the screen, where it is possible to look in the face of who you are speaking to).

Very Good 
2006-08-13
The Apple iSight is a very expensive webcam, but if you compare the quality of image, ease of use, and the elegance and versatility of the design to its competition (the magnetic mount is wonderful) I have to give a guarded thumbs up to the iSight. It is the superior product, but the price is high, and its not problem free:
1) It gets very hot, very quickly, and stays that way as long as you're using it (this has not caused any problems though.)
2) The microphone in my Apple iMac G5 Desktop with 17" M9843LL/A (1.8 GHz PowerPC G5, 512 MB RAM, 160 GB Hard Drive, DVD/CD-RW Drive) is clearer than the iSight's: People I connect to always ask me to change the iSight mic back to the built in iMac mic. Volume is the same.
( ADDENDUM March 23, 2007: The sound situation recently reversed and people began to say that my iSight's mic was much better, so I don't know WHAT to tell you about that one. I'm going to try and do some kind of test to clarify exactly what is going on but until then at least you know the camera gives you an option.)
The image is by far the best that I've seen of any webcam. I didn't experience the soft edges reported by a prior reviewer, but did get serious pixelation during some connections; however, that is more likely a problem of data transmission than a camera or software defect (I've also had problems connecting to PC/Logitech users via AIM, but I'm hesitant to blame that on the iSight, because iSight to iSight connections are very good.)
The software (which downloads from Apple when you install the iSight) seems to be glitch free, and automatically places the image right under the iSight, so you appear to be looking into the camera when you are looking at person you are speaking to.
Ease of use is typically Mac: plug and play. Effortless. The fact that its a FireWire connection leaves me with one more USB slot (which I needed) so I'm happy about that too.
A good product, but its expensive and there is some room for improvement (which is not likely to happen now that iSights are included in new Mac computers.) I would buy it again.

Wonderful, but no longer available 
2008-06-12
Would you believe there's an inexpensive substitute available from... Microsoft? The Xbox 360 Live Vision Camera is natively compatible with OSX 10.4.9 and up (see http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Xbox_Live_Vision_Camera)
The Live Vision Camera is not as beautiful and sophisticated as the iSight. It doesn't have autofocus (you focus it manually by turning the lens barrel) or a shutter to prevent unwanted video spying (instead a green ring glows around the lens when the camera is on).
Still, the picture quality is excellent, the camera is much smaller, convenient and portable than the original iSight, and you can't beat the price.
A great alternative to the iSight now that it is no longer manufactured.
